This class discusses the unique lowness of humans: their ability to desire anything other than G-d.While even the most impure animals are created with a natural subjugation to G-ds will, and are forced to follow his will, only humans are capable of choosing something against G-d. We discuss how everything is enlivened by G-dliness or “Klipa”- a spiritual energy that covers up G-dliness, and how that affects the way we interact with the world.

This episode introduces chapter 29:We discuss the Beinoni’s challenge called “Timtum Halev”, a closed off heart, specifically referring to an inability to open one’s heart to G-d in prayer. What causes this blockage to occur even in a Beinoni? And how should one deal with this issue? In this episode, we reassess our entire relationship with G-d and how we think of Him in our lives.

“Mayim Rabim” - Discourse on Parshat Noach In this class we discuss the two levels of “Noach”- rest, and how we can reach them. We discuss the state before and after the flood, and how the flood purified the world as a stepping stone to a new state of existence. We also speak of turbulent “waters of Noach” in our experience- the challenges we face each day, and how to utilize them to ultimately uplift us to an even higher level.
